Lucia Simonelli

Climate-policy scientist; 2026 Democratic candidate in Pennsylvania's 1st Congressional District

Lucia Simonelli is a mathematician and climate-policy researcher from Quakertown, Pennsylvania. She holds a PhD in mathematics from the University of Maryland and completed a UNESCO postdoctoral fellowship that took her to teach in countries including Iran and Ecuador. She later worked as a researcher and scientific adviser on energy and climate policy in the U.S. Senate, in the office of Senator Sheldon Whitehouse, and has worked for a Washington, D.C. nonprofit on federal climate policy. She ran in the May 19, 2026 Democratic primary for Pennsylvania's 1st Congressional District, losing to Bob Harvie. [Lucia Simonelli Wants PA-01 Democrats to Vote Their Hopes, Not Their Fears ↗]
